My wife and I spent last Thanksgiving in Cocoa Beach Florida (about one hour drive south of Datona). We had a great time. It is close to the Kennedy Space center (the tour is fabulous),one hour drive to Orlando or Daytona and there was a very nice drive thru Christmas light display nearby. Plenty of restaurants with Thanksgiving menus. The Cocoa Beach Pier is small but nice views of the volleyball players and surfers.If you are interested, there are several casino boats that will take you out for a nice evening, even if you don't gamble. They will pick you up at your hotel or wherever you are staying.
It was one of our most enjoyable vacations.
